Original Owner After Almost 12 Years
I’m updating my ‘Original Owner After 10 Years’ review below. Almost two more years on the ‘09 F150 5.4 FX4 s/crew and it’s still going basically trouble free. I just put its second set of new brake pads / rotors on along with new calipers as well, I also installed a new Cat back exhaust on it however the old exhaust was still basically fine. In the fall of ‘19 for some reason the hood heat/ noise insulator pad started deteriorating so I replaced that. I also have new Motorcraft coil packs and fuel injectors just because I think they’ll perk the 5.4 up a bit but haven’t installed them yet. I figure if I put $1000 of extra maintenance in wear parts a year into it that’s a bargain compared to a monthly new truck payment so that’s my plan with a truck in excellent condition of this age. Overall for a truck going on 12 years old that’s been paid off since 2014 I’m way ahead of the game with this F150 FX4, nice 09-14 styles are starting to thin out now now so this one draws as much or more attention as when it was new. It’s still my daily driver and looks basically like when it came off the dealers lot so I’m going to try and get another 10 years out of it just because I’m sure I probably can. I’d be pretty careful if I was buying one used now however as they’re not all in the condition that mine is. I will say that since 2009 this truck has never let me down and has never broke down once although I credit that to proper maintenance and fixing little issues before they become big problems.

A little choppy on dirt roads, feel the uneven paved
A little choppy on dirt roads, feel the uneven paved road surfaces. I attribute this to the 4X4 suspension. Excellent payload , 1865 lbs.for the non-turbo 3.3 liter which has been stellar performer in 35K miles. I average 24mpg all weather. Very good drive modes, sport kicks it up to V8 feel, shift on the fly seamless. Handles great with loads 1000 lbs. plus. Hot riding vinyl seats are sport like hugging you, difficult to turn around to look out the back window. I don't rely solely on back up camera because it does hide the corners where pedestrians are. Confining driving position barely allows for my 6 foot frame. Seats belong in a sports car, not a truck! I should have got the cloth seats! The cab lacks much space behind seats for a small cooler of water or duffel bag. The transmission was clunky in the first 4 months. I think it was the computer adjusting for driving habits. The 12" touch screen has many features and can be turned off. Integrated phone is easy set up, Personal music can be played or built in music apps. The maps are great showing satellite view and North South configuration based on direction view. Service often freezes when you get in valleys. The worst feature is vehicle manual on computer, takes 10x longer to find what you are looking for. Ask Ford to order a printed booklet! The instrument panel is well laid out however the steering wheel sometimes obstructs information. The tilt, telescope wheel is perfect for shorter drivers. There are many cluster views to choose from and two trip odometers, a big plus. I choose one layout for all driving. Took a long time to get used to where radio controls are as I was always turning down the blower motor switch. Blower motor has 8 speeds and whisper quiet up to 5. Also has an ac booster for quick cab cooling, heat, nice! The stereo has equalizer, 4 speakers and will blow out your ear drums unless you have deafness. I find the adjustments for instrument brightness, headlights, fog, and bed lights to be very awkward, An afterthought by Ford engineers? Placed at lower left below segregated instrument layout. Needs to be easily visible, not hidden from view and adjustment. The high beams light up the next county and 50 feet up the treeline. Not sure I need to see owls in the trees, but I can. The flash to pass feature needs to be more blinks, changing lanes that fast is dangerous. The windshield is large and raked offering a full road view and pillars don't obstruct the roadway. The rear view camera can be used while driving and shows tailgaters. The rear window has defrost, tint. The tint is great but defrost is imo a dumb idea. Window easily defrosts with heat or defogs with ac. This isn't a car! I chose Ford over competition because my last F150 gave me 400K, never left me stranded, had a great V6, super good tranny and decent fuel mileage. I like the payload, handling, maps and my music from my apps. I like the aluminum clad where my last steel truck started rusting everywhere. The weight is nimble feel while driving, almost sporty on twisty roadways with very good acceleration and quicker stopping. The cost of ownership is less than foreign and many domestic. I have no recalls in 2 years. I drive in snow often, the handling and my confidence level are excellent but I still have weight in the bed for traction since this is 700 lbs. lighter than my 2013. Overall, I like this vehicle very much and look forward to a new one, better designed or upgraded 2028.

Trucker with a Purpose- F150 HEV, Best Truck Yet
On July 26, 2022 I picked up my fourth F150. This one was different. It was the first one I ordered (waited 10 mths.), the most costly and a hybrid. Now, almost a year later, I find I am greatly enjoying the truck. It tows 7000# with ease, is quiet, and the feature set is fantastic. Each rendition of the F150 has been better. I started with the 2009. Nice but heavy. The 2015 was the first aluminum one and I did have some trouble with the brake controller failing and catching fire. The 2017 was great but in its last year it developed a dripping leak when raining in the sunroof that thankfully I was able to fix. It was the best up until this one. The recalls-windshield motor and flickering taillights (LED flash). My motor was fine and the taillights were reprogrammed. I would say that is minor compared to my friend's Red Silverado who in 2015 got a notice that they were catching fire on rear defroster wiring! I haven't had any issues and I am just amazed at the technology. It drove me 200 miles to Tallahassee. I cannot wait for the BlueCruise update supposedly this year. I get about 3mpg better than my 2017 10spd, Ecoboost in town and about 1mpg better on the highway. It varies but that is about the average. Ecoboosts can be thirsty if you want power. They like to cruise so I have learned to get to speed, not crawl up and keep a light foot. I own a truck because I need one to tow my camper and I need one to serve dual purpose as a daily driver too. I find that the Ford F150 fits that bill. I have shopped all the choices on full size pickups. The only other truck, to me, that met my needs with positive factors was the GMC Denali diesel half ton. I was not impressed with the overall package of the Tundra, RAM or Titan. They did not check all the boxes for me. I look for comfort, MPG, engine/power/torque RPM power curve for towing, tow features, style, etc. The hybrid eco and the diesel blow the others away for low RPMs while towing which is torque and that makes for a more enjoyable tow. Less noise , stress, etc. My two finalists also got the best MPG. I leaned toward the hybrid more too because of the current stance on diesels and the DEF and the cost of the fuel compared to regular gas. As a long time sports sedan owner turned trucker, I would tell you to shop. Read and research but some facts, well, aren't facts. I remember my legacy of sports sedans and buying recommended models- LOL. The Lexus- bad radios- all of them on the lot, cyclops brake light bulb not replaceable when blown, BMW 328is coupe- bad electrical battery blew up 2yrs., Infiniti G38 jerking and slamming 8spd. auto transmission on Interstates on quick braking- these were all top rated/reviewed cars and not cheap. I had more trouble with those three than any other vehicles I ever have owned. If you are looking for a truck, a vehicle meant for hauling and towing, then I highly recommend an F150. There is a reason they have such high sales in spite of what some reviews say.

Great for work and family.
This is my first hybrid and is also my first Ford. In the past I've had many cars including an indestructible Honda Civic. This review will "compare" with the Civic because the Civic left the biggest impression on us for great reliability and cheap parts. The reason I gave the review 4 stars for reliability is because I had a minor coolant leak (a rusted hose clamp) and Ford charged me $250 to fix the hose clamp. I never had any problems with the Civic we used to have and if we did it was ultra cheap to fix it. Besides the minor problem the Ford C-Max has been great!!! I absolutely Love the high ceiling in the C-max. My head has plenty of room and I'm 6 feet tall. Much more room than the Civic. The Civic had 140hp and this Ford has 188hp, so its much faster than the civic! Also, The C-max costs me $35 in gas every TWO weeks!!! The last two cars I had I was spending $25-40 in gas in one week! So its faster, better gas mileage and more spacious and roomy than pretty much any car I've had lately. So far my experience with my first ford is very good. I like the style, the space inside and the comfort. I got the SE model instead of the Titanium so it doesn't have some bells and whistles. Overall I really enjoy the C-Max. I'm one of the very few people who thinks it looks cool. As for my future purchases... Ford is now on my radar!

Generally the styling is nice, you really can see where
Generally the styling is nice, you really can see where the older Escape was used as the basis for this vehicle. The interior is nice and comfortable. Ford missed the mark on storage. The dead space behind the screen, as one example. You can buy a bin that will fit very nicely in that spot. Mileage has been good. Road noise can be a little much as times, and the ride can get a little jittery at speed. There is an odd shudder between 35 and 40mph, that the service tech said is from "cylinder deactivation". Ford and other manufacturers have had this technology for a long time. Seems hard to believe that Ford would screw it up. Was told that it happens in Eco or Normal mode. In Sport mode it's less noticeable, and doesn't really effect the mileage that much. Tried it, didn't see much of a difference. Other issue is legroom in the back seat. I'm 6'4" (and it's surprisingly easy for me to get in and out), but I need to have the seat back a bit. Leaves very little room for a back seat passenger. Overall, pretty good vehicle. Hopefully in the next gen, they'll correct some of these issues.

Which Ford vehicle has the best MPG?
The Ford Fusion Hybrid can reach up to 43 MPG city and 41 MPG highway for a combined rating of 42 MPG. The Ford Maverick with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 42 MPG city and 35 MPG highway for a combined rating of 38 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
Which Ford vehicle has the longest range?
The electric Ford F-150 Lightning can travel up to 320 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options. The plug-in hybrid Ford Escape PHEV can travel up to 37 electric-only miles before the gas engine kicks on.
E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
